Planning application
Land at and to the rear of 72 North Street and 2 Bedford Street, Leighton Buzzard, LU7 1EN
Works: New dwelling Extension Demolition
Refused. Only the applicant can appeal, within the statutory time limit, and a revised scheme can be submitted instead.
Proposal
Conversion and extension of 72 North Street to provide 6 x no. 1 bedroom flats. Conversion of 2 Bedford Street to provide 2 x no. 2 bedroom flats. Erection of independent block of 7 x no. 1 bedroom flats and 5 x no. 2 bedroom flats. Associated parking, paths, fences and relocated vehicular access. Demolition of workshop at 2 Bedford Street.
